How To Get Visa Extended and Renewed in Quang Tri

Quang Tri is a province in Vietnam that’s located in the North Central Coast region of the country, and the north of Hue, the former imperial capital. The province borders the former Demilitarized Zone that separated North and South Vietnam until 1975. As the most heavily war-impacted province in Vietnam, most of the foreigners who are based in Quang Tri are working on humanitarian projects, such as the clearing of landmines. Thus, the Vietnam Immigration Office has established an office here.

Located in 19 Le Loi street, Ward 5 in Dong Ha City, the Vietnam Immigration Office in Quang Tri can assist foreigners with all their Immigration-related concerns, including visa extension and renewal.

How To Get Visa Extension in Quang Tri

If you need your Vietnam visa extended, the first thing you need to do is to fill out the NA5 form. This form is available at the Vietnam Immigration Office in Quang Tri, although you can also get a copy of this form online, from the website of the Vietnam Immigration. Print a copy of this form and fill it out completely. Bring this to the Vietnam Immigration Office along with your passport and visa copy.

At the Immigration Office, the staff will verify the documents and will advise you if they need additional requirements to process your visa. If not, they will ask you to pay the processing fee so they can start processing your visa extension request. The process will take around 3 to 5 working days. But it could take longer, depending on the Vietnam Immigration. If you need it earlier, you can have it expedited for an added fee.

How To Get Visa Renewal in Quang Tri

If the visa extension will not work for your situation, the visa renewal is a good option. With the visa renewal, you will be issued a new visa that will let you stay longer in Vietnam. You also get to choose the type of visa to apply for when getting a visa renewal. This is the best option for foreigners who entered Vietnam with no visa since they came from countries that are eligible for visa-free entry into the country.

When getting a visa renewal in Quang Tri, you will be asked to fill out the application form at the Vietnam Immigration Office. You also need to submit your passport, which should be valid for at least six months from the validity date of your new visa. There will be a processing fee that you need to pay, and the cost will depend on the type of visa that you have chosen to apply for. The cost or processing fee for the visa renewal is more expensive compared to the visa extension. However, you will not be required to go out of the country anymore, so it’s still a cheaper and more convenient option.

What’s the Difference Between Visa Extension and Visa Renewal?

Both the visa extension and visa renewal will allow you to stay longer in Vietnam, even after your visa expires. But which option will work best for you? What are the differences between the two?

If you will apply for the Vietnam visa extension, the Vietnam Immigration Department will extend the validity of your existing visa. However, you need to exit the country before your current visa will expire. When you re-enter, you will still be using the same visa. The Vietnam Immigration will immediately stamp your passport for re-entry since your visa’s validity has already been extended.

With the visa renewal, you will be given a new visa. When you choose this option, you are like applying for a new visa, which is why it costs more. But the best thing about this visa is you no longer need to extend your stay. Once you will be given a new visa, you can continue staying in the country, depending on the validity of the new visa that you have applied for. This option is highly recommended if you did not use any visa when you entered the country, as part of the visa exemption policy.
